MySQL主从复制(Master-Slave) 原理详解

https://www.cnblogs.com/gl-developer/p/6170423.html

MySQL数据库自身提供的主从复制功能可以方便的实现数据的多处自动备份,实现数据库的拓展。多个数据备份不仅可以加强数据的安全性,通过实现读写分离还能进一步提升数据库的负载性能。

原理时序图:

Created with Raphaël 2.1.2主服务器主服务器从服务器从服务器数据更改写入二进制日志I/O线程与主服务器保持通信读取二进制日志写入中继日志写入中继日志SQL线程:读取、重放

MySQL主从复制(Master-Slave) 原理详解